IELTS Writing Task 2 Topic:Should governments provide free internet access for all citizens?


Model Answer:

In today's highly connected world, the importance of internet access cannot be understated. It has become an essential tool for communication, education, and employment opportunities. Therefore, providing free internet access to all citizens is a matter worth considering by governments. This essay will discuss the pros and cons of this proposition, analyzing the potential benefits for individuals as well as the financial implications for the government.

On one hand, offering free internet access to all citizens can have several positive effects. Firstly, it would create an environment of digital equality, where everyone has the same opportunity to access information and learn new skills. This would help to bridge the gap between underprivileged and privileged communities and reduce social inequalities. Secondly, free internet access could boost economic growth as small businesses and entrepreneurs could use this tool to expand their reach. Lastly, it would contribute to a more informed society, where citizens can stay updated on news and current affairs, ultimately promoting active participation in democracy.

However, there are also several drawbacks to consider when implementing free internet access for all citizens. One major concern is the financial burden this initiative may impose on governments. Establishing a reliable infrastructure for widespread internet access requires significant investment in hardware, software, and maintenance. Additionally, potential misuse of the internet, such as cybercrime and online harassment, could pose security risks that require additional resources to address.

In conclusion, while free internet access for all citizens presents numerous benefits, including digital equality, economic growth, and an informed society, it is essential to acknowledge the financial implications and potential drawbacks. Governments should carefully weigh these factors before deciding whether or not to provide free internet access to their citizens.
